Barack Obama to buy rare £20,000 gold ring for his wife.
The ring is made of rhodium - the world's most expensive metal --encrusted with diamonds. It is being hastily made by Italian designer Giovanni Bosco in time for January's inauguration ceremony.
Only about 25 tons of rhodium are mined each year, mostly in South Africa, and as a result its price is typically around £5,000 an ounce.
